Cornell University did a study on the impact apples have on your brain. This study indicated that the ingredients in apples are able to help keep your brain cells from deteriorating as we age. Which means that by eating apples you are able to minimize the risk of getting Alzheimer’s.

The ingredients needed to cook Non Veg Uttappam/Dosa:
  1. Prepare 2 cups Rice
  2. Take 3/4 cup Black Gram or Urad Daal
  3. Use 1 tsp Salt or to taste
  4. Use 1 tsp Fenugreek Seeds
  5. Prepare 1 tbsp Bengal Gram or Chana Daal
  6. Get 400 gm Chicken
  7. Get 1 tsp Salt
  8. Provide 1 tsp Chilli Garlic sauce
  9. Get 1 tsp Cumin powder
  10. Get 1 tsp Garam masala
  11. Provide 1 Sprig Curry Leaves
  12. Use 1 small bunch Coriander Leaves finely chopped
  13. Take 1 tbsp Butter
  14. You need 1 tsp Oil
  15. Get 2 cups Mixed Vegetables
Steps to make Non Veg Uttappam/Dosa:
  1. Soak both the rice and dal separately for 5-6 hours. Use fresh drinking water for soaking them. Soak Bengal Gram and Fenugreek Seeds with the dal.
  2. Grind them using water in which they have been soaked and make a thick batter. The batter should be like a dosa batter, a semi thick one with a pouring consistency.
  3. Adjust Salt according to taste and leave it to ferment overnight. The next day, chop all the veggies and set aside if you are using them. In a pan, heat butter with oil and add some Curry Leaves.
  4. Now add the Chicken cubes as small as possible along with all the other spices. Saute them on a medium flame stirring at regular intervals. Cover and let it cook for 10 minutes. It does not take much time as the cubes are very small. If the batter is very thick, adjust by adding little water and then proceed.
  5. Heat a cast iron griddle or a non stick tawa and pour a ladleful of the batter. Spread it in clockwise direction to as thin as possible. Drizzle some Oil or Ghee.
  6. First top with the veggies and cover. I have used Onions, Capsicum and Tomatoes. Keep the heat on a medium high. After 2 minutes, add the sauteed chicken and spread all the toppings evenly. Garnish with some coriander leaves too for a final touch. Serve this right away just with a hot mug of filter coffee. It requires nothing else as an accompaniment.
